Linseed Oil Market Revenue Outlook: What CAGR Lies Ahead Through 2030?
The linseed oil market has experienced substantial growth in recent years. It is anticipated to expand from $3.69 billion in 2025 to $3.91 billion in 2026, demonstrating a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.0%. Historically, this growth has been influenced by factors such as the expansion of construction and furniture industries, the traditional application of linseed oil in paints, increased flaxseed cultivation, a rising demand for natural binding agents, and its growing usage in animal feed.
The linseed oil market size is anticipated to experience substantial growth over the upcoming years. It is projected to reach $4.91 billion by 2030,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.8%. This expansion during the forecast period is driven by factors such as increasing demand for bio-based coatings, growing consumption of omega-3 supplements, the proliferation of sustainable building materials, a rising preference for organic edible oils, and increased utilization in eco-friendly paints. Key developments expected during this period include a heightened demand for natural and organic oils, greater adoption of linseed oil in wood finishing, its expanded use in nutritional applications, a stronger emphasis on cold-pressed processing, and a boost in demand from the paint and coatings industry.

Linseed Oil Market Growth Drivers: What’s Behind The Acceleration?
The expanding paint and coating sector is anticipated to fuel the future growth of the linseed oil market. This industry focuses on producing materials designed to protect, adorn, and improve surfaces in sectors such as construction, automotive, and various industrial applications. The industry’s expansion is driven by technological progress, a growing need for protective and decorative solutions in construction and automotive sectors, and an increasing focus on eco-friendly and sustainable products. Linseed oil benefits the paint and coating industry by serving as a natural binder that boosts durability, delivers a smooth finish, and enhances the drying and hardening characteristics of oil-based paints and coatings. For instance, in October 2024, AkzoNobel, a Netherlands-based paint and coating manufacturing company, reported that its organic sales for the third quarter (Q3) of 2024 grew by 1% compared to the second quarter (Q2). This uplift was due to increases in coating volumes, including high single-digit growth in marine and protective coatings and mid-single-digit growth in powder coatings. Therefore, the increasing utilization of linseed oil in the paint and coating industry is a key driver for the linseed oil market.

Linseed Oil Market Trends: What’s Defining The Industry’s Next Phase?
Leading companies in the linseed oil market are strategically focusing on sustainable practices and direct-to-consumer (DTC) sales to increase their market penetration, lessen environmental impact, and enhance customer interaction. This approach helps them strengthen their competitive position and foster long-term expansion. DTC sales enable businesses to sell products directly to consumers, bypassing traditional retail channels, while sustainability efforts aim to minimize waste and integrate renewable resources into production. For example, in March 2023, Archer Daniels Midland Company (ADM) unveiled the Knwble Grwn brand to supply consumers with sustainably produced, plant-based food ingredients. The Knwble Grwn assortment features flaxseed, hemp seed, flax oil, hemp oil, and quinoa. These ingredients are promoted as nutritious selections for consumers who prioritize sustainable food choices.
